"Allegorical Figure of a Woman with a Shield or a Mirror" is a painting by the renowned Italian artist Giovanni Battista Tiepolo. Tiepolo, born in Venice in 1696, is celebrated for his distinctive style that blends the grandeur of the Baroque with the lightness and elegance of the Rococo. His works are characterized by their vibrant color palettes, dynamic compositions, and masterful use of light and shadow.
The painting in question, "Allegorical Figure of a Woman with a Shield or a Mirror," is a fine example of Tiepolo's allegorical works. Allegory was a popular theme in the 18th century, often used to convey complex ideas and moral lessons through symbolic figures and imagery. In this painting, Tiepolo depicts a female figure, whose identity and symbolic meaning can be interpreted in various ways based on the attributes she holds.
The woman in the painting is shown holding either a shield or a mirror, objects that carry significant symbolic weight. A shield often represents protection, defense, or warfare, while a mirror can symbolize self-reflection, truth, or vanity. The ambiguity of the object in her hand adds to the enigmatic quality of the painting, inviting viewers to ponder its deeper meaning.
Tiepolo's skillful use of color and light is evident in this work. The figure is bathed in a soft, luminous glow, which highlights her serene expression and graceful posture. The drapery of her clothing is rendered with exquisite detail, showcasing Tiepolo's ability to depict texture and movement. The background is kept relatively simple, ensuring that the focus remains on the central figure.
The painting is also notable for its composition. Tiepolo employs a dynamic arrangement, with the figure slightly off-center and her body turned in a gentle twist. This creates a sense of movement and liveliness, drawing the viewer's eye across the canvas. The use of diagonal lines and curves adds to the overall sense of fluidity and grace.

While specific details about the commission or the original context of this painting are not readily available, it is likely that it was created for a private patron or as part of a larger decorative scheme. Tiepolo was highly sought after by European nobility and clergy, and his works adorned many palaces, churches, and public buildings.
Today, Giovanni Battista Tiepolo is regarded as one of the greatest painters of the 18th century, and his works continue to be admired for their technical brilliance and artistic innovation.
